繁体   English   中英

Firebase 云 Function 计划创建文档

[英]Firebase Cloud Function schedule to create document

We have a Flutter project with Firebase setup we would like to create a Firebase cloud function with node js that perform the following:

每个月的 27 日从订阅集合中检查订阅日期。 并在发票集合中创建一个新文档,然后最终发送 email 和 FCM 以及付款 URL。

为此,您需要使用 预定的云 Function

更准确地说,您需要:

  • 根据需要安排云 Function,例如使用0 0 27 * * ,即在每月 27 日的 00:00。
  • 在 Cloud Function 中,查询您的 Firestore 集合以获取“检查订阅日期”
  • 在云 Function 中,发送 email。 例如通过触发 Email 扩展 这实际上只是在 Firestore 集合中创建一个文档的问题,有关更多详细信息,请参阅本文
  • 在云 Function 中,按照文档中的 说明发送 FCM。

对于最后 3 点,您需要使用 Admin SDK,因为您在 Cloud Function 中进行编码。 Firestore 文档和消息传递文档

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M